The most common and recent 9-letter answer for "Music players discontinued in 2017" is IPODNANOS.
The clue refers to a specific line of Apple's portable media players, the iPod Nano, which was discontinued in 2017. 'Music players' indicates the general category, while the year hints at a notable event related to the product.
This clue was last seen in the NYT Crossword on November 25, 2025.
iPod Nanos are small, portable media players designed by Apple, known for their compact size and ability to play music and other media.
